On 01.07.2014 01:10, Li, Zhen-Hua wrote:
When malloc for jump,
if (head && location) {
	jump = xmalloc(sizeof(struct jump_key));
	....
}
And here it is used:
if (head && location && menu == location)
	jump->offset = strlen(r->s);


So I think when jump is used, it must not be NULL; then !=NULL is not needed.

I tested the patch against v13.6-rc5. It fixes the problem with the warning.

You can add

Reviewed-by: Heinrich Schuchardt <xypron.glpk@xxxxxx>

On 30.06.2014 05:16, Li, Zhen-Hua wrote:
There is a warning when run "make menuconfig".

scripts/kconfig/menu.c: In function ‘get_symbol_str’:
scripts/kconfig/menu.c:591:18: warning: ‘jump’ may be used uninitialized in
this function [-Wmaybe-uninitialized]
       jump->offset = strlen(r->s);
                    ^
scripts/kconfig/menu.c:551:19: note: ‘jump’ was declared here
    struct jump_key *jump;
                     ^

It is because the compiler think "jump" is not initialized, though in fact
it is already initialized.

Signed-off-by: Li, Zhen-Hua <zhen-hual@xxxxxx>
---
   scripts/kconfig/menu.c | 2 +-
   1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)

diff --git a/scripts/kconfig/menu.c b/scripts/kconfig/menu.c
index a26cc5d..584e0fc 100644
--- a/scripts/kconfig/menu.c
+++ b/scripts/kconfig/menu.c
@@ -548,7 +548,7 @@ static void get_prompt_str(struct gstr *r, struct property *prop,
   {
   	int i, j;
   	struct menu *submenu[8], *menu, *location = NULL;
-	struct jump_key *jump;
+	struct jump_key *jump = NULL;

   	str_printf(r, _("Prompt: %s\n"), _(prop->text));
   	menu = prop->menu->parent;

Hello Zhen-Hua,

the patch looks incomplete to me. A check
jump != NULL
should be added before accessing parts of structure jump_key.
